Output 81ba6348c807817554f2ecd157ed9e0e2d48c64fafad3bcbd18a67f940fc75fa:0

value
14980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c9ebb8658b8350407adbca1c85b5564b28a5b5 OP_EQUAL
address
34mg7aNBGRxPa5V37cuCg7XdpoeK6Le5AB
transaction
81ba6348c807817554f2ecd157ed9e0e2d48c64fafad3bcbd18a67f940fc75fa
spent
true